Subject: [PATCH] Add an initial set of privilege support to OpenDS.  The current privileges are currently defined and implemented: * config-read (allow reading the configuration) * config-write (allow updating the configuration) * ldif-import (allow invoking LDIF import tasks) * ldif-export (allow invoking LDIF export tasks) * backend-backup (allow invoking backup tasks) * backend-restore (allow invoking restore tasks) * server-shutdown (allow invoking server shutdown tasks) * server-restart (allow invoking server restart tasks) * server-restart (allow invoking server restart tasks) * password-reset (allow resetting user passwords) * update-schema (allow updating the server schema) * privilege-change (allow changing the set of privileges for a user)
